Medicaid is a kind of health insurance that is made available to Americans in particular low-income tax brackets. Whether or not someone is eligible for Medicaid greatly depends on income and various particulars like if the individual has dependents and whether or not they are receiving any other assistance. Medicaid might even pay for the expenses having relating to drug and alcohol rehab, and there are quite a few drug and alcohol treatment centers throughout Holyoke, Colorado which are approved through Medicaid. Quite a few drug treatment centers that are covered through Medicaid may only deliver a limited rehab plan and might only provide such treatment on a short term basis, usually 30 days or less. Treatment clients in Holyoke, Colorado who receive Medicaid should research which programs include the highest level of rehab for the longest period of time to reap the complete results of such a drug and alcohol rehab program.
